Overview
Gold wire is carefully drawn from refined gold, renowned for its exceptional malleability, ductility, and resistance to tarnishing, ensuring long-term reliability in specialized applications. Sourced through mining operations or recycling processes, this precious metal is purified to meet stringent quality standards for industrial use. Gold wire is widely utilized in precision applications, such as semiconductor manufacturing, electrical connectors, and medical devices, where its superior conductivity and corrosion resistance are critical. Its recyclability further enhances its appeal, making gold wire a sustainable and high-performance choice for advanced technology industries.

Properties
- Composition: Typically high-purity gold, often 99.9% or greater.
- Density: 19.32 g/cm³.
- Melting Point: 1,064°C (1,947°F).
- Color: Bright yellow, shiny, and lustrous.
- Malleability: Extremely malleable, can be drawn into very thin wires.
- Ductility: Highly ductile, among the most ductile metals.
- Electrical Conductivity: Excellent conductor, resistivity ~2.44 μΩ·cm at 20°C.
- Thermal Conductivity: High, ~317 W/(m·K) at 20°C.
- Corrosion Resistance: Highly resistant, does not tarnish or oxidize.

Applications
- Semiconductor bonding
- High-end electronics
- Jewelry
- Medical devices
